The stages of change model, also known as the Transtheoretical Model, is the model used to describe how behaviors are modified. It was first introduced in the late 1970s by Carlo C. DiClemente and J.O. Prochaska. These researchers introduced the model while studying the stages of change in addiction. This model describes five stages that people go through on their way to change: precontemplation, contemplation, preparation, action, and maintenance. According to the stages of change, behavior change does not occur rapidly or easily, it is an ongoing process. The five stages of change are often used in health promotion and disease prevention and can be applied in any setting and by anyone.
